This fall, you can literally get lost in Lainey Wilson’s world and I don’t mean her songs. A company called Maize is cutting her face into over 30 cornfields around the country. Yep, a Lainey Wilson corn maze. They’ve done it before for Reba McEntire and Luke Bryan, so it’s kind of a country music tradition now. Honestly, nothing says fall like pumpkin spice lattes, hayrides, and wandering through a corn maze shaped like Lainey’s big ol’ hat.  The closest one to us…is at the All-Seasons Orchard in Woodstock, IL
